Logging here gives you a private place to validate what happened to you, helping you feel more in control on your healing journey. It is private, anonymous, and institution-free.
You may add as little or as much information as you like to your log. If you just want to click ‘Submit Log’ without providing any information, you are welcome to do that. You’ll be able to return to your private log and add more later.
If you choose to answer any optional questions, it will take you about 5 minutes to complete.

Do you want to know more about the log form?
There will be a space for you to type anything you want. It is designed to be private to you. You’ll be able to return to your private log to read, edit, delete, or add more.
You’ll be asked if you would like to view 6 optional demographic questions.
You’ll be asked if you would like to view 4 optional questions about barriers to services (reporting, medical, mental health, and legal).
You’ll be asked if you would like to answer an optional question about whether it happened within the past year or more than a year ago.
Optional answers are stored separately from your private log and are not designed to be linked back to it.
Optional demographic, barrier, and timing answers may be combined with other responses and used without identifying you.
Optional feedback and “Other” write-ins may be reviewed as written only after there are enough submissions to display them safely.
We are aiming to understand the barriers survivors face to reporting and seeking medical, mental health, and/or legal services.
After submitting your log, you’ll receive a unique access code.
Your access code lets you return to your private log.
Please save this code to return later.
